Planning for the Setup
First of all, the sustaining frame supplied with the bathroom must be fitted (if called for) according to the supplier's guidelines. Next, fit the taps or mixer to the tub. When fitting the tap block, it is very important to make certain that if the faucet includes a plastic washing machine, it is fitted between the bathroom and the faucets. On a plastic bathroom, it is also reasonable to fit a supporting plate under the faucets unit to prevent strain on the bathtub.
Fit the flexible tap connectors to the bottom of the two taps using 2 nuts and olives (in some cases supplied with the tub). Fit the plug-hole outlet by smearing mastic filler round the sink electrical outlet opening, and afterwards pass the electrical outlet via the hole in the bathroom. Make use of the nut provided by the maker to fit the plug-hole. Take a look at the plug-hole electrical outlet for an inlet on the side for the overflow pipe.
Next off, fit completion of the versatile overflow pipe to the overflow electrical outlet. After that, screw the pipe to the overflow face which should be fitted inside the bathroom. See to it you utilize all of the supplied washing machines.
Attach the trap to the bottom of the waste outlet on the bath tub by winding the string of the waste outlet with silicone mastic or PTFE tape, as well as screw on the trap to the electrical outlet. Attach all-time low of the overflow tube in a similar manner.The bath should currently prepare to be fitted in its final placement.
Removing Old Touches
If you require to replace old taps with brand-new ones as a part of your installment, after that the first thing you ought to do is disconnect the water supply. After doing so, activate the taps to drain pipes any type of water remaining in the system. The procedure of getting rid of the existing taps can be quite problematic because of the restricted access that is often the situation.
Use a container wrench (crowsfoot spanner) or a faucet tool to reverse the nut that links the supply pipes to the faucets. Have a fabric ready for the continuing to be water that will come from the pipelines. Once the supply pipes have been eliminated, use the exact same tool to loosen up the nut that holds the taps onto the bath/basin. You will require to quit the single faucets from turning during this procedure. Once the faucets have been gotten rid of, the holes in the bath/basin will certainly need to be cleaned up of any kind of old sealing substance.
Before moving on to fit the new faucets, compare the pipe links on the old taps to the new faucets. If the old taps are longer than the brand-new faucets, after that a shank adapter is required for the new faucets to fit.
Installing the Tub
Using the two wood boards under its feet, place the tub in the called for setting. The wooden boards are helpful in uniformly spreading out the weight of the tub over the location of the boards instead of concentrating all the weight onto four tiny points.
The next objective is to ensure that the bathtub is leveled all round. This can be accomplished by examining the spirit level as well as readjusting the feet on the bathtub up until the level reviews degree.
To install taps, fit all-time low of the outermost flexible tap port to the ideal supply pipe by making a compression sign up with; after that do the exact same for the various other faucet.
Switch on the supply of water as well as examine all joints and also brand-new pipework for leaks and tighten them if needed. Load the bath tub and also inspect the overflow outlet as well as the typical electrical outlet for leakages.
Ultimately, fix the bath paneling as described in the producer's instruction manual. Tiling as well as securing around the bathtub ought to wait up until the tub has actually been made use of at the very least when as this will certainly resolve it right into its last position.
Fitting New Touches
If the tails of the brand-new faucets are plastic, after that you will need a plastic adapter to stop damages to the string. One end of the adapter fits on the plastic tail of the faucet as well as the various other end gives a link to the current supply pipelines.
If you require to fit a monobloc, after that you will certainly need minimizing couplers, which links the 10mm pipeline of the monobloc to the typical 15mm supply pipeline.
Next off, place the tap in the installing hole in the bath/basin guaranteeing that the washers remain in area in between the tap and the sink. Protect the faucet in place with the manufacturer provided backnut. As soon as the tap is securely in position, the supply pipelines can be linked to the tails of the taps. The faucets can either be linked by using corrugated copper piping or with regular tap connectors. The previous kind must be connected to the tap finishes initially, tightening only by hand. The supply pipelines can later on be linked to the various other end. Tighten both ends with a spanner after both ends have actually been linked.
Tiling Around the Tub
In the area where the bath fulfills the ceramic tile, it is required to seal the joins with a silicone rubber caulking. This is important as the installation can move enough to fracture a stiff seal, causing the water to pass through the wall surface between the bathroom and also the tiling, causing complications with wetness as well as possible leakages to the ceiling listed below.
You can select from a selection of coloured sealers to blend in your components as well as fittings. They are marketed in tubes as well as cartridges, and can sealing voids as much as a width of 3mm (1/8 inch). If you have a bigger gap to load, you can fill it with twists of soaked paper or soft rope. Keep in mind to always load the tub with water prior to sealing, to allow for the motion experienced when the tub is in usage. The sealant can fracture relatively early if you do not take into consideration this movement prior to sealing.
Conversely, ceramic coving or quadrant tiles can be made use of to edge the bathroom or shower tray. Plastic strips of coving, which are easy to use and reduce to size, are additionally easily readily available on the market. It is suggested to fit the ceramic tiles using water-resistant or water-proof adhesive and also cement.

Steps to Install a Freestanding Bathtub:
STEP 1: Place the protective blanket in the adjacent area where you want to install the bathtub. It will help you protect the bathtub's sides when you do the installation.
STEP 2: Now, place the 4x4 lumber in the area where you want to install the bathtub. Place the bathtub on top of the lumber, and align the drain line with the bathtub drain.
STEP 3: A freestanding bathtub comes with a drain kit. If not, make sure you purchase one with your bathtub. You can pop that drain kit and align it with your bathroom drain line. Ensure that you tighten the drain nut enough so there is no water leakage. You must also clean the bathtub’s drain to remove the factory dirt and debris.
STEP 4: Clean the drain hole in your bathroom. It helps to do the installation without any water blockage. A drain cleaner or bleach will suffice. Once the drain dries entirely, take a small amount of clear silicon and place it around the underside of the pipe flange.
STEP 5: Attach the drain tailpiece to the bottom of the bathtub. Place the rubber or plastic bushing with the plumbing material at the top of the tailpiece and screw the drain nut up the tube until it tightens both the bathtub’s drain and the drain tailpiece. Now you must add the lubricant to the seal to ensure there is no water leakage in the pipe connection.
STEP 6: Place caulk around the bottom edge of the bathtub. Take out the lumbar support and carefully bring the bathtub to the floor. Use a damp cloth to clean the excess caulk and debris and plumber putty to cover the tub drains and the floor.
